Vaccines can be scary and carry a level of risk at least in the mind. Your body receives an agent that resembles a disease-causing microorganism often made from weakened forms of the disease microbe or its toxins. This implies that a semblance of COVID-19 is introduced to your body. Yet without this process resistance and victory over the disease cannot be attained.
